190 changes: 190 additions & 0 deletions lib/mix/tasks/ExAtomVM.install.ex
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,190 @@
defmodule Mix.Tasks.Exatomvm.Install do
use Igniter.Mix.Task

@example "mix igniter.new my_project --install exatomvm@github:atomvm/exatomvm && cd my_project"

@shortdoc "Add and config AtomVM"
@moduledoc """
#{@shortdoc}

## Example

```bash
#{@example}
```

"""

@impl Igniter.Mix.Task
def info(_argv, _composing_task) do
%Igniter.Mix.Task.Info{
# Groups allow for overlapping arguments for tasks by the same author
# See the generators guide for more.
group: :exatomvm,
# dependencies to add
adds_deps: [{:pythonx, "~> 0.4.0"}],
# dependencies to add and call their associated installers, if they exist
installs: [],
# An example invocation
example: @example,
# A list of environments that this should be installed in.
only: nil,
# a list of positional arguments, i.e `[:file]`
positional: [],
# Other tasks your task composes using `Igniter.compose_task`, passing in the CLI argv
# This ensures your option schema includes options from nested tasks
composes: [],
# `OptionParser` schema
schema: [],
# Default values for the options in the `schema`
defaults: [],
# CLI aliases
aliases: [],
# A list of options in the schema that are required
required: []
}
end

@impl Igniter.Mix.Task
def igniter(igniter) do
selected_instructions =
Igniter.Util.IO.select(
"What device do you want to show instructions for?\n(Project is configured for all devices - this is just for further flashing instructions):",
["ESP32", "Pico", "STM32", "All"]
)

IO.inspect(selected_instructions)

options = [
start: Igniter.Project.Module.module_name_prefix(igniter),
esp32_flash_offset: Sourceror.parse_string!("0x250000"),
stm32_flash_offset: Sourceror.parse_string!("0x8080000"),
chip: "auto",
port: "auto"
]

Igniter.update_elixir_file(igniter, "mix.exs", fn zipper ->
with {:ok, zipper} <- Igniter.Code.Function.move_to_def(zipper, :project, 0),
{:ok, zipper} <-
Igniter.Code.Keyword.put_in_keyword(
zipper,
[:atomvm],
options
) do
{:ok, zipper}
end
end)
|> Igniter.mkdir("avm_deps")
|> Igniter.Project.Module.find_and_update_module!(
Igniter.Project.Module.module_name_prefix(igniter),
fn zipper ->
case Igniter.Code.Function.move_to_def(zipper, :start, 0) do
:error ->
# start function not available, so let's create one
zipper =
Igniter.Code.Common.add_code(
zipper,
"""
def start do
IO.inspect("Hello AtomVM!")
:ok
end
""",
placement: :before
)

{:ok, zipper}

_ ->
{:ok, zipper}
end
end
)
|> output_instructions(selected_instructions)
end

defp common_intro do
"""
Your AtomVM project is now ready.
Make sure you have installed AtomVM itself on the device:
(make sure to choose the Elixir enabled build)
"""
end

defp output_instructions(igniter, selected_instructions)
when selected_instructions == "ESP32" do
igniter
|> Igniter.add_notice(selected_instructions)
|> Igniter.add_notice("""
#{common_intro()}
https://www.atomvm.net/doc/main/getting-started-guide.html#flashing-a-binary-image-to-esp32 (binary available)

you can also use the web flasher (using Chrome):
https://petermm.github.io/atomvm-web-tools/
""")
|> Igniter.add_notice("""
You are now ready to flash your project to your device using:

mix atomvm.esp32.flash

ExAtomVM will automatically download the flashing tools needed on first flash.
(port is in "auto" mode and will find first connected ESP32)

[https://github.com/atomvm/exatomvm?tab=readme-ov-file#the-atomvmesp32flash-task]
Optionally set port in the command or specify in mix.exs
mix atomvm.esp32.flash --port /dev/ttyUSB0
""")
end

defp output_instructions(igniter, selected_instructions)
when selected_instructions == "Pico" do
igniter
|> Igniter.add_notice(selected_instructions)
|> Igniter.add_notice("""
#{common_intro()}
https://www.atomvm.net/doc/main/getting-started-guide.html#flashing-a-binary-image-to-pico (binary available)

""")
|> Igniter.add_notice("""

You are then ready to flash your project to your device using:

mix atomvm.pico.flash [https://github.com/atomvm/exatomvm?tab=readme-ov-file#the-atomvmpicoflash-task]
""")
end

defp output_instructions(igniter, selected_instructions)
when selected_instructions == "STM32" do
igniter
|> Igniter.add_notice(selected_instructions)
|> Igniter.add_notice("""
#{common_intro()}
You need to build AtomVM for your board:
https://www.atomvm.net/doc/main/build-instructions.html#building-for-stm32

And have st-link installed to flash:
https://github.com/stlink-org/stlink?tab=readme-ov-file#installation
https://www.atomvm.net/doc/main/getting-started-guide.html#flashing-a-binary-image-to-stm32
""")
|> Igniter.add_notice("""
You are then ready to flash your project to your device using:

mix atomvm.stm32.flash [https://github.com/atomvm/exatomvm?tab=readme-ov-file#the-atomvmstm32flash-task]
""")
end

defp output_instructions(igniter, selected_instructions)
when selected_instructions == "All" do
igniter
|> output_instructions("ESP32")
|> output_instructions("Pico")
|> output_instructions("STM32")
end

defp is_mac? do
case :os.type() do
{:unix, :darwin} -> true
_ -> false
end
end
end
